WebNov 16, 2008 · All combinations of IgG subclass deficiency may be seen in CLL. IgG subclass deficiency (64.6%) is more common than low total IgG (30.6%) and the rate of infection (16%). WebStage 0: CLL cells are in the blood. Stage 1: CLL cells are in large lymph nodes. Stage 2: An enlarged liver or spleen from CLL.
